## Pixelwright CLI 3.2.0 — Changed Defaults

Batch resize jobs now default to Lanczos filtering instead of bilinear, and output quality for JPEG targets has been raised from 82 to 90. Plugin authors relying on the old defaults should pin them explicitly in their manifests. The full set of shipped defaults is listed below.

settings of bafof-fajog:
[aldix]
port = 9300
region = north-3
host = aldix.kelvilabs.example
team = istath
timeout_ms = 1500
retries = 8

- [ ] Step 7: Archive cold storage buckets (Glacierline tier). Confirm both ceremony witnesses are present, verify bucket manifests match the Oxbow ledger, then seal the archive key shares. Plugin authors may observe but not handle shares. Once sealed, the archive index itself is encrypted and can only be reopened with the passphrase below.

vault phrase of badup-hahig = tamael-aldael-kelmir-istael-fenok-istwyn-tamius-jorath-oliion

**Ticket PRT-2291: Intermittent connection failures after monthly partition rollover**

Since the Ledgerline reporting cluster adopted month-based table partitioning, clients see connection resets during the first hour of each month while new partitions are created and indexes built. The partition-maintenance job holds locks longer than expected, exhausting the pooler. We propose pre-creating partitions two months ahead. For the security review, note that the maintenance job authenticates as a dedicated role using the connection string below.

primary connection of yagep-kahip = redis://giliel_svc:zYiKsLL2PLpfPL@db-348f.xolmarsys.corp:5432/fenwyn

TURN-208: Gatevale turnstile counters at the Merrow Field pilot double-count when a rotation reverses mid-cycle. Attendance totals drift roughly 2% high per event. The debounce window fix is implemented, reviewed by Ilsa, and soak-tested across two simulated match days without drift. Ready for your cut; the candidate build is identified below.

trace token, tagag-tafog: htk6_5ed18c